Malta blocks EU's new Russia sanctions over shipping sector fears
Malta is currently blocking new EU sanctions against Russia over fears that a proposed price cap on Russian energy will disproportionately impact Malta’s shipping sector.The new sanctions would, among other measures, cap the price of Russian energy exports at 15% below market value.Diplomatic sources told Times of Malta that while Malta agrees with the cap...
